Since the LCD touch display is a non-standard product with many parameters and sizes, many customers will encounter the same problem when purchasing an LCD touch display, that is, they need to carry out custom development, and then open the mold for proofing and confirm the sample before mass production. 1.Requirements communication
Before proofing, it is necessary to communicate with the customer to confirm the customer's needs for the sample, such as size, resolution, IC, display mode, viewing angle, wiring, glass, backlight, application scenarios and many other product parameters. The black and white screen is a non-standard product, and it needs to be opened. Therefore, it is necessary to inform the customer that the cable arrangement and backlight need to be opened, and to communicate the mold opening and proofing fee.
2. Drawing confirmation
After confirming the customer's needs, the LCD touch display manufacturer will arrange for the engineering department to issue CAD drawings to the customer. Generally, the drawings are issued in about 3 days. After the customer confirms and signs the drawings, this CAD drawing is the final basis for the two parties to reach an agreement. After the sample is completed, it will be confirmed according to the parameters on the drawing.
3. Mold making
After the drawing is confirmed, the LCD touch display manufacturer will find the relevant mold manufacturer to open the mold and proof. The progress and quality of the entire mold opening need to be controlled by the LCD manufacturer.
4. Sample production
When the LCD touch display manufacturer has prepared the molds and materials and passed the acceptance inspection, the sample production can be carried out. Under normal circumstances, the sample production cycle takes about 15-18 days.
5. Sample test
After the sample is made, it is necessary to carry out appearance test and performance test on the sample to confirm whether the sample is qualified and issue a relevant test report. For some industrial touch display samples with high requirements, aging test, sensitivity test, vibration test, etc. are also required to ensure the reliability of the sample.
6. Packaging and delivery
Since the main material of the sample is glass, which is fragile, special attention should be paid to the packaging of the sample to ensure that the sample can reach the customer in good condition. After the customer receives the sample, the light test will be carried out on the sample. If the test is OK, it means that the sample is qualified and can meet the customer's needs.
